Graduates of Springfield College-Regional Online and Continuing Education earn a median salary of $48,036 ten years after enrollment. Median student debt at graduation is $26,250, with an estimated monthly loan payment of $278.

| Outcome Metric | Value |
|---|---|
| Median Earnings (6 Years After) | $43,692/yr |
| Median Earnings (8 Years After) | $45,448/yr |
| Median Earnings (10 Years After) | $48,036/yr |
| Median Student Debt | $26,250 |
| Est. Monthly Loan Payment (10yr) | $278/mo |
| 3-Year Repayment Rate | 55.0% |
Springfield College-Regional Online and Continuing Education has 176 undergraduate students. The student body is 59.8% female. About 31.4% are first-generation college students. The average age at entry is 27.6.
| Student Metric | Value |
|---|---|
| Total Undergraduates | 176 |
| Female Students | 59.8% |
| First-Generation Students | 31.4% |
| Average Age at Entry | 27.6 |
| Students Over 25 | 95.3% |
